Arkansas community leaders visit 33rd FW
U.S. Air Force Tech. Sgt. Richard Flower, a 33rd Maintenance Squadron fuels maintainer, briefs civic leaders about the fuels section at Eglin Air Force Base, Florida, July 10, 2024. 19 community leaders surrounding Ebbing Air National Guard Base, Arkansas, traveled to Eglin to familiarize themselves with the 33rd FW mission, highlight the capabilities of the F-35A Lightning II, and learn about the heritage and history of the Nomads. 33rd FW hosts 19th AF Warhammer Rally
19th Air Force commanders and chiefs finish viewing an F-35A Lightning II during the 19AF Warhammer Rally at Eglin Air Force Base, Florida, April 4, 2024. During the rally, they observed an array of 4th and 5th aircraft generation in a large force exercise, which demonstrated the integration of different unit missions across the 19th AF flying community. 33rd FW hosts 19th AF Warhammer Rally
An F-35A Lightning II assigned to the 33rd Fighter Wing receives fuel from a KC-135 Stratotanker assigned to the 97th Air Mobility Wing over the skies of Florida, April 04, 2024. The KC-135 Stratotanker is a unique asset that enhances the Air Force's capability to accomplish its primary mission of global reach through aerial refueling.
